Sarina Takes Listeners On An Emotional Journey with Yu-Utsu na Michi (Melancholy Roads)

Tokyo-based alt-pop artist Sarina is back with her latest single, Yu-Utsu na Michi (Melancholy Roads), and it is breathtaking. It is her first single written in Japanese and English, a testament to her ability to create a compelling narrative with her thoughtful and vivid lyrics. Her vocal delivery takes the listener on an immersive journey, plunging them into a bittersweet story of pursuing dreams, no matter how lonely or scary they might be.

The production is top-notch, seamlessly fusing ethereal soundscapes with guitar-driven choruses. It is a perfect blend of melancholy and hope, with Sarina’s dynamic vocals and raw, vulnerable storytelling at the forefront. The song is accompanied by a stunning anime and gaming-inspired music video that perfectly captures the song’s mood.

Sarina explains that “the inspiration for the song came from the solitude of chasing her dreams. Yu-Utsu na Michi is a free fall of a daydream that leaves your reality forever changed. Sometimes, the passion that burns inside you is so bright that it blinds you to the solitude of life. It is beautiful and warm and crackles with the promise of what you could be. For me, the road I followed while chasing my dreams often led to isolation. The joy of what I can be glowed alongside the loneliness of the beautiful but lonesome world.”

Yu-Utsu na Michi (Melancholy Roads) takes the listeners on an unparalleled emotional journey. Don’t miss out on this sparkling alt-pop gem.
